Description

Sometimes, the path to what you really want to do with your career is winding, but the rewards are even sweeter once you get there. Today’s guest started with nothing and built a successful company before selling it to dive headfirst into real estate. On this episode of Zen and the Art of Real Estate Investing, Jonathan interviews Todd Pigott, the principal and managing member of the ZINC companies, which are wide and varied in the real estate space. They consist of ZINC Financial, ZINC Income Fund, ZINC Auto Finance, and ZINC Realty, one of the largest rehabbers in California. As they begin their conversation, Jonathan and Todd explore Todd’s background with real estate, which began when he started a facilities maintenance company as a means of survival while still a college student. He ran that business for 17 years before selling it and pivoting to real estate, establishing the ZINC companies. Todd outlines the typical borrower who works with him, explains the balloons and confetti syndrome in real estate, and the three things he can guarantee for his investors. He also describes how he maps out trends across the country, how market differences impact investors, and why inexpensive markets may be attractive but often don’t produce great results. Jonathan and Todd share why they love Google Street View and Google Earth for evaluating a property’s location, rental standards to look for in the surrounding area, and using the Government Services Administration to assess a market. Finally, they discuss why the current market is probably not a real estate bubble and why no crash is on the horizon. Todd Pigott’s depth of understanding of real estate investing offers valuable takeaways every investor—new and experienced—can learn from. What if you could learn from experienced real estate investors, find out what got them to where they are now, get insight into their daily habits, and take these insights to inspire your own growth? That’s what each episode of Zen and the Art of Real Estate Investing brings. Hosted by Jonathan Greene, a real estate investor for more than 30 years, as well as advisor and coach, the founder of Streamlined Properties and the Team Leader of Streamlined Properties On-Market, brokered by eXp Realty, every episode is an in-depth look at the mindful approach to real estate investing. If you are looking to start from scratch, get to the next level, or just for a straightforward and honest approach to real estate investing, Zen and the Art of Real Estate Investing is the free mentorship program you can take with you anywhere.
